Hip Pain

Hip pain can be caused by a variety of factors, including injury, overuse, or arthritis. Physiotherapy is a common treatment option for hip pain and can help individuals manage their symptoms and improve their quality of life.
During a post-surgery physiotherapy session, a physiotherapist will evaluate the individual’s condition and develop a personalized treatment plan. The treatment plan may include exercises to improve flexibility and strength, manual therapy, and education on proper body mechanics.
Common exercises used in physiotherapy for hip pain include stretching and strengthening exercises for the hip and surrounding muscles. Manual therapy techniques such as soft tissue mobilization and joint mobilization may also be used to help relieve pain and improve joint function.
In addition to exercise and manual therapy, a physiotherapist may also use modalities such as heat or cold therapy, electrical stimulation, and ultrasound to help relieve pain and promote healing.
It’s important to note that the success of physiotherapy for hip pain depends on the individual’s commitment to their treatment plan and making lifestyle changes to prevent future episodes of pain. Working closely with a physiotherapist can help individuals manage their pain and improve their quality of life.
